The city has received much national attention recently for its dramatic price appreciation over the last year (an appreciation that's been compared to that of 2004-2005). However, going from $78/SF to $94/SF in 2012 (+$22,500 for a 1,500SF home) isn't nearly as dramatic as going from $125/SF to $165/SF in 2005 (+$60,000 for a 1,500SF home).
For this reason, in addition to the tighter lending and appraisal guidelines of today, there is a lot of room for future appreciation in the Phoenix residential real estate market.
